Title:
  apt-key does not print "Key fingerprint =" in front of fingerprints

Status in apt package in Ubuntu:
  Triaged

Bug description:
  A common idiom for checking fingerprints for keys begins with:
  ' apt-key fingerprint $key|grep fingerprint|...'
  ... this works up to thru jessie at least.. in zesty apt-key gives a 
'warning' but produces no output.

  "Warning: apt-key output should not be parsed (stdout is not a terminal)"
  If the lack of output is intended and is meant to be a proscription, it is 
overreaching at best. A warning makes perfect sense.
